Subject: ReportForge sort stability fix shipping tonight

On-call: the 4.12.2 patch for ReportForge replaces the unstable quicksort in the column sorter with a stable merge sort. Customers saw row order flip between identical exports; that stops now. No schema changes, no migration. Rollback is a straight redeploy of 4.12.1 if export latency regresses past 20%. Watch the sorter-latency dashboard for two hours post-deploy. The canary build is identified by the token below.

pipeline stamp: htk31_f769b577b3028a4e9958e5bb8d1259a

Changelog — QuickSeek autocomplete, 2024-w31

Defaults changed after last week's latency complaints. Index refresh interval lowered, prefix cache doubled, and fuzzy matching now off by default on the Pellford cluster. Cold-start rebuilds dropped from 14 min to 6. Teams overriding old defaults should remove their overrides and re-test. Rollback path exists through the snapshot from w30. The new default configuration values for the sync's reference follow below.

config for tagep-yajef:
ulawyn:
  log_level: error
  metrics_host: metrics.ulawyn.lumiclabs.internal
  pin: 0564
  pool_size: 32

Handover for Gridloom, our crossword generator. The nightly batch finished clean, but the theme-word scorer is still flagging too many obscure entries; Priya bumped the rarity threshold to 0.7 as a stopgap. If puzzle output stalls, restart the solver worker first. Full queue stats and retry steps are on the internal page here.

operations page: https://jenkins.zemvarcloud.local/job/merge_requests/repo/build/73930b4b30f0a8ed